/* IE6用 */
* html body .contentsInner { width:520px; padding-left:0px; padding-right:0px; margin-left:25px;}

.deli_p1 {
	margin-top: 10px;
	margin-bottom: 10px;
}

.deli_p2 {
	margin-top: 10px;
	margin-bottom: 0px;
}

.deli_p3 {
	margin-top: 20px;
	margin-bottom: 20px;
}

.deli_p4 {
	margin-top: 10px;
	margin-bottom: 20px;
}

.deli_p4 a {
	color: #0099cc;
	text-decoration: underline;
}

.deli_img1 {
	margin-top: 20px;
	margin-bottom: 20px;
}

.deli_img2 {
	margin-top: 10px;
	margin-bottom: 30px;
}

.deli_h4_1 {
	margin-top: 30px;
}

.deli_h5_1 {
	margin-bottom: 20px;
}


/*--------------------------------------------
/ 宅配の仕組み */

.nextBox {
	width: 117px;
	float: left;
	margin-right: 15px;
	padding-bottom: 15px;
}

.nextBox02 {
	width: 115px;
	float: left;
	padding-bottom: 15px;
}

.nextBox03 {
	width: 158px;
	float: left;
	padding-bottom: 15px;
}

.nextBox p,
.nextBox02 p {
	color: #ff6b22;
}

.deliverybtBox {
	margin-top: 15px;
	margin-bottom: 25px;
}

.deliverybtBox ul {
	margin: 0px;
	padding: 0px;
}

.deliverybtBox ul li {
	list-style: none;
	font-size: 0px;
	line-height: 0px;
	float: left;
	margin-right: 20px;
}

.deliverybtBox ul li.btLast {
	margin-right: 0px;
}

.entryBox {
	margin-bottom: 20px;
}

.entryBox strong {
	display: block;
	width: 330px;
	float: left;
}

.entryBox p {
	width: 330px;
	float: left;
}

.entryBox .bt {
	float: right;
	width: 174px;
	text-align: right;
	margin-top: 5px;
}

ul.listvar02 {
	margin-bottom: 30px;
}

ul.listvar02 li a {
	color: #0099cc;
	text-decoration: underline;
}

/*--------------------------------------------
/ 名古屋 */

#listBtn {
	margin-bottom: 30px;
}

#listBtn img {
	float: left;
}

#listBtn p {
	float: right;
	width: 360px;
	margin: 0px;
}

#aboutArea {
	width: 310px;
	float: left;
	margin-top: 15px;
}

#aboutArea strong {
	display: block;
}

#aboutArea ol {
	padding: 0px;
	margin-top: 0px;
	margin-right: 0px;
	margin-bottom: 20px;
	margin-left: 25px;
}

#aboutArea ol li {
	margin: 0px;
	padding: 0px;
	list-style-position: outside;
}

#aboutArea p {
	padding: 0px;
	margin-top: 0px;
	margin-right: 0px;
	margin-bottom: 20px;
	margin-left: 0px;
}

#aboutPhoto {
	width: 198px;
	float: right;
	margin-top: 15px;
}

.baseBox {
	margin-top: 10px;
}

.baseBox img {
	float: left;
	margin-right: 10px;
}

.baseBox p {
	margin: 0px;
}

.seikyuTable {
	margin-top: 10px;
}

.seikyuTable td,
.seikyuTable th {
	padding: 5px;
}

.changeTable {
	margin-top: 10px;
}

.changeTable td {
	padding: 5px;
}

.changeTable th {
	padding: 5px;
	vertical-align: top;
}

.seikyuTable p,
.changeTable p {
	margin: 0px;
}

p.qbox img {
	float: left;
	margin-right: 5px;
}

p.qbox span.qtxt {
	 display: block;
	 width: 450px;
	 float: left;
	 margin-top: 10px;
}

p.abox {
	margin: 0px;
}

p.abox img {
	float: left;
	margin-right: 5px;
}

p.abox span.atxt01 {
	 display: block;
	 width: 450px;
	 float: left;
	 margin-top: 5px;
	 margin-bottom: 10px;
}

p.abox span.atxt02 {
	 display: block;
	 width: 360px;
	 float: left;
	 color: #ff6600;
}

p.abox span.atxt03 {
	 display: block;
	 width: 450px;
	 float: left;
	 margin-top: 5px;
}

p.abox span.atxt04 {
	display: block;
	color: #666666;
	margin-top: 10px;
}

.qaBg {
	background-image: url(../../image/nagoya_p24.png);
	background-repeat: no-repeat;
	background-position: right 34px;
}

.qaBg02 {
	background-image: url(../../image/nagoya_p25.png);
	background-repeat: no-repeat;
	background-position: right 34px;
}



.otBtnset {
	margin-left:40px;
	margin-top:20px;


}

.otBtnset a {
	background-image: url(../../image/ot_btn_set_nagoya_b.png);
	background-repeat: no-repeat;
	background-position: left top;
	height: 116px;
	width: 458px;
	display:block;
}

.otBtnset a:hover {
	text-indent: -9999px;
}



/*--------------------------------------------
/ 東京 */

#kitchenArea {
	width:520px;
	margin-bottom: 20px;
}

.boxBg {
	background-image: url(../../image/tokyo_p06.jpg);
	background-repeat: no-repeat;
	background-position: right bottom;
}


/*----産直----*/
p.txtNomal {

	color: #666666;
}





